Ben Medlock: Touchscreen typing is an inference problem, not a mechanical one
“This is a virtual keyboard, and the problem of typing was now not a mechanical problem. It's an inference problem, and that means that there is a degree of uncertainty.”

Medlock: SwiftKey chose independent probability distributions over neural networks for tractability
“And we took the first one of these because it's a lot easier and a lot more tractable.”
Medlock: N-gram models are extremely hard to beat in voice recognition
“If you've done anything in voice recognition, you will know that it's really, really hard to beat Ngram models.”

SwiftKey scraped the entire public internet to train its language models
“We scraped all of the publicly available texts off the internet and dumped it into language specific buckets.”

SwiftKey used Large Hadron Collider grid infrastructure to process language models
“So we, ah, we partnered with the University of Cambridge in the UK to use the European grid, which was put together to analyze the data from the Large Hadron Collider, which is why I show you this picture.”
SwiftKey's initial touch model used Gaussian distributions to map keypresses
“The system that we first built was to use Gaussian distributions to model the interaction of the person with the keyboard surface, and then we can use a linear Gaussian for the space bar, and the others are single point Gaussians.”
SwiftKey continuously retrains its touch model on-device as users type
“We build all this technology that runs on the phone. So while you're tapping on the keyboard, it's retraining via a re-parameterized version of MAP.”
SwiftKey saved users 15 trillion keystrokes out of 50 trillion typed characters
“We've had about 50 trillion characters written through the software, and we saved about 15 trillion keystrokes”
